Private ADHD Diagnosis

Private ADHD assessments are increasingly common. However, some GPs will refuse to sign a shared-care agreement following an assessment at private clinics, which could hinder patients from receiving the care they require.

In England In England, you have the right to choose the place your GP will refer you to for an ADHD assessment. Some alternative providers provide shorter wait times and can also do medication titration via video call.

BBC Panorama's investigation into inadequate ADHD services offered in England has brought the condition back to the forefront. The NHS has long waiting lists for assessments, private ADHD assessment for adults which have kept many people suffering from ADHD from receiving the support they require. Private clinics can offer shorter waiting times and can conduct assessments via video call.

In contrast to a standard psychiatric test unlike a standard psychiatric assessment, an ADHD assessment is more thorough and includes psychometric questionnaires and interviews. It also covers different aspects of your life, such as problems at school and in adulthood and how they affect your daily functioning. It is beneficial to have family members present to take part in this assessment.

After you've completed the test your doctor will give you an overview of the results. The report will contain the scores of all the questionnaires and psychometrics that you completed, as being a comprehensive listing of your past and current symptoms and impairment. The report will also recommend medications and a treatment trial.

Then, you'll receive the complete report, and you can discuss it with your GP to determine whether they'll prescribe ADHD medications on the NHS. It's not always possible as many GPs want to see three months of stability in order to prescribe medication.

It's important to remember that, despite paying privately for a medical service it's not legal for healthcare professionals to break the rules. Your healthcare professional must still adhere to the guidelines set by NICE.

Waiting at various times

ADHD is a well-known disorder that can result in significant impairment for many people. Many people fail to get the proper diagnosis because of the long NHS wait times. Many have sought private treatment because of this. It is important to be aware that private diagnosis is not without risk. The process is lengthy and requires the involvement of family members.

Psychiatrylogo-IamPsychiatry.pngIn the UK Patients are often required to wait for years before getting an accurate ADHD diagnosis. A recent study by Sky News found that some people have been waiting more than five years for an appointment. A few of these issues result from doctors who don't know how they can screen for ADHD or by healthcare professionals who have preconceived notions about what an ADHD diagnosis looks like.

The NHS must address the issue of long wait times for adults suffering from ADHD and increase funding in this area. In addition, there is a need for consistent and routine reporting. This will allow the NHS to discover and eliminate inequalities in service delivery. At present, there is no national mandated system for data collection, and only certain regions collect data about their services.

Many people believe that NHS waiting times are too long and are looking for other options. One option is your Right to Choose scheme, which lets you request your GP to recommend you to a different service. This can cut down on the time required to receive an assessment.

GPs can now use their Right to Choose in England when referring patients to an ADHD assessment. This is a good option for those who require an early diagnosis and are willing to pay for the test. But, it's important to remember that the NHS is not able to pay for private healthcare providers.

A private ADHD diagnosis is usually quicker than a NHS one. However, it is important to consult your GP about the wait times in your region. This way, you'll avoid the risk of being directed to a psychiatrist who may not be capable of diagnosing you quickly.
